Construction works at Vulcanesti Electrical Substation completed – substation ready for energization

The construction works at the Vulcanesti Electrical Substation have been completed, marking an important milestone for the commissioning of the Vulcanesti–Chisinau Overhead Power Line, one of the largest energy infrastructure projects of Moldova.

During the final stages, the necessary technical tests were carried out and the results confirmed that the installations are ready for energization and powering up. At the same time, all three phases of the substation have been connected and the final technical adjustments are currently being made before commissioning.

The completion of the construction works and the successful tests allow the project to move to the energization phase of the Vulcanesti Electrical Substation and its associated infrastructure. The acceptance procedures are to be carried out in the immediate future.

The electrical substations in Vulcanesti and Chisinau are key assets for the commissioning of the Vulcanesti–Chisinau Energy Independence Line.

In parallel, works are ongoing at the Chisinau Electrical Substation: construction of the exterior container has been completed and the installation of protection cabinets continues. The responsible teams are preparing the necessary connections for integrating the substation into the national power system.

“For the commissioning of the Vulcanesti–Chisinau Line, the Chisinau Electrical Substation also needs to be completed, where the works are in their final phase. Commissioning this overhead line will eliminate the risk of energy blackmail, given that the current line passes through the Kuchurgan power plant, which is not located on the territory controlled by Moldova, creating the risk of a discretionary disconnection. The Independence Line will allow the transmission of electricity from Romania and the European market directly to the center of the country, bypassing the Kuchurgan hub,” said Energy Minister Dorin Junghietu.

The Vulcanesti–Chisinau Overhead Power Line was completed in November 2025, has a length of approximately 157 kilometers and will connect the 400 kV Vulcanesti Electrical Substation with the 330 kV Chisinau Electrical Substation. The project is being implemented under the Power System Development Project, financed by the World Bank Group.
